Also, pay attention to support for modern communication protocols. A CAN FD diagnostic tool is essential for working on newer vehicles, such as those from General Motors manufactured from 2019 onwards. An FCA AutoAuth function is required to access protected systems on Fiat-Chrysler Group vehicles (from 2018 onwards).

Vehicle technology is constantly evolving. Regular software updates are therefore crucial to ensure compatibility with new vehicle models and functions. Check how long updates are included in the purchase price and what costs are incurred thereafter. Models with lifetime free updates offer a clear cost advantage here.
The connection to the vehicle can be wired or wireless. An OBD2 scanner with Bluetooth or a Wi-Fi-based device offers more flexibility and freedom of movement in the workshop.

This means that the device is capable of communicating with all electronic control units (ECUs) in the vehicle. While simple OBD2 scanners often only access the engine control unit, an "all-system" device can also read and clear faults in the ABS, airbag system (SRS), transmission, climate control, infotainment, and many other modules.
Yes, many professional diagnostic tools, like the ones presented here, offer corresponding functions as a vehicle coding tool. This allows you to, for example, teach new components to the vehicle (e.g., a new battery or injectors), unlock hidden convenience features, or adjust vehicle settings. However, the exact scope of coding capabilities depends heavily on the vehicle make, model, and year of manufacture.
CAN FD (Flexible Data-Rate) is a more modern and faster data bus protocol used in many newer vehicles (e.g., from GM, Ford, BMW). Without CAN FD support, a diagnostic tool can perform no or only very limited diagnostics on these vehicles. FCA AutoAuth is a security gateway used by the Fiat Chrysler Automobiles (FCA) group since 2018. To do more than just read fault codes on these vehicles (e.g., perform service resets or active tests), the diagnostic tool requires official authorisation via this gateway.
